BUILD PRODUCTION-READY BACKEND WITH NESTJS AND PRISMA
Go from knowing NestJS to engineering scalable backends — with Prisma, Docker, BullMQ, WebSockets, Stripe, and PayPal
Trusted by over 50,000 students around the world
You’ve probably followed countless tutorials.
Each time you build a small “auth app” or “todo project,” it feels like progress —
but when you sit down to build something real, everything falls apart.
Suddenly:
Migrations fail in Docker
Auth Tokens break after login
You are debugging CORS instead of writing business logic
You don’t need another 10-hour tutorial.
You need a system — the same architecture and workflows real companies use to build and deploy production-grade backends.
That’s exactly what this course gives you.
THE PROGRAM
What You’ll Learn in Production-Ready Backend with NestJS & Prisma

WHAT THIS COURSE WILL HELP YOU:
✅ Build real-world, production-ready backends using NestJS and Prisma — the same tools used by top tech companies.
✅ Learn how to combine powerful technologies like Docker, Postgres, BullMQ, and Stripe to create a complete backend system from start to finish.
✅ Gain real experience that helps you confidently apply for NestJS developer jobs and stand out from other candidates.
✅ Move forward in your career toward becoming a full-stack developer with hands-on backend experience.
✅ Qualify for higher-paying opportunities — employers love developers who can build real production systems.
✅ Boost your confidence — after this course, you’ll feel ready to work on any NestJS project at your job or with clients.
✅ Start freelancing immediately — confidently bid on NestJS projects knowing you can deliver professional results.
✅ Make your portfolio stronger — show real, production-ready projects that impress recruiters and clients.
✅ Win interviews easily — hiring managers will see that you already have the skills and experience they need.
MODULE 1
Project Setup
In this module, you'll learn how to set up the Nestjs project and architecture
MODULE 2
Database and Authentication
This module will teach you how to integrate PRISMA ORM with Postgres DB, run migrations, and implement JWT Authentication with Referesh Token, Roles Guards
MODULE 3
Core Features, Teams, Projects and Tasks
In this module, you'll learn how to create a relationship between Prisma Models
MODULE 4
Email Notification
This module will teach you how to send emails in Nestjs. Admin can invite any team member to join the team.
MODULE 5
Project Features and Transactions
In this module, you'll learn how to implement transactions in PRISMA ORM
MODULE 6
Indexing
This module will teach you how to implement indexing in Prisma and Postgres
MODULE 7
Tasks Feature
This module will teach you how to implement pagination, filtering, and advanced Prisma relations
MODULE 8
Best Practices, Security, Error Handling, Logging and Swagger
This module will teach you how to implement security best practices, Error Handling, and logging using Winston and documentation with Swagger
MODULE 9
Deployment
This module covers how to create separate env files for deployment, and deploy the DB and Nestjs app to production
MODULE 10
Testing Prisma Application
This module will teach you how to do unit, integration, and end-to-end testing in Nestjs and a Prisma application
MODULE 11
BullMQ
You will learn how to use BullMQ to schedule the background jobs, like CRON Tasks
MODULE 12
WebSocket
You will learn how to build real-time applications using WebSocket
MODULE 13
WebRTC
This module covers how to build a video communication app like Zoom or Google Meet
MODULE 14
Stripe
Every SAAS app needs to integrate a payment gateway like Stripe. You will learn how to integrate Stripe with Nestjs
MODULE 15
PayPal
You will also learn how to integrate PayPal with Nestjs.
Before the Course
You follow tutorials that stop at CRUD.
You manually fix config issues every week.
You struggle to explain architecture in interviews.
You waste weekends debugging.
You feel “almost ready” for a backend job.
After the Course
You build full-stack APIs that scale and deploy
You use Dockerized, repeatable environments.
You speak confidently about production-ready systems.
You automate, deploy, and focus on features.
You are production-ready — with a real portfolio project.
FAQs
GOT QUESTIONS?
QUESTION
I already know NestJS — will this still help?
ANSWER
Most courses stop at syntax — this one teaches production-grade systems: scaling, payments, and real-time modules
QUESTION
What if I get stuck?
ANSWER
You’ll have lifetime access, full source code, and a support community.
QUESTION
I’ve never deployed any Nestjs project — is it too advanced?
ANSWER
Every step is shown on screen, you will be able to deploy any personal nestjs projects
QUESTION
Is it worth?
ANSWER
You’ll save months of trial and error — this pays for itself in the first week of real work
How it works?
Enroll today for $49 (limited-time launch price)
Get Instant Access to all course modules.
Follow the complete roadmap to build your backend
Deploy it live and showcase it in your portfolio
Ready to Become Production-Ready?
Learn to design, build, and deploy real backends — with NestJS, Prisma, and Docker.
I offer a 30-day money-back guarantee with this purchase. You can try for 30 days. If it does not work, you will get your money refunded
Bonus: NestJS Microservices Mastery ($99 value)
$49
$200
USD VAT/Tax inclusive
Create Your Free Account